Output 8396ea868ecb8d87e1d19d55a6205688143e91c85c28bd9ecad4a578e76d4e0f:1

value
3768204
script pubkey
OP_0 OP_PUSHBYTES_20 8a647280bab715d009121deb0aea741bdaca1cae
address
bc1q3fj89q96ku2aqzgjrh4s46n5r0dv589w736r2r
transaction
8396ea868ecb8d87e1d19d55a6205688143e91c85c28bd9ecad4a578e76d4e0f
confirmations
139736
spent
true